How To Fix RSDDTPS068 - Updating of Explorer settings started


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RSDDTPS - Messages for Polestar Index Maintenance

  • Message number: 068

  • Message text: Updating of Explorer settings started

    The SAP error message RSDDTPS068, which states "Updating of Explorer settings started," typically indicates that there is an issue related to the settings or configuration of the SAP BusinessObjects Explorer or the SAP BW (Business Warehouse) system. This message can occur during the process of updating or refreshing settings in the Explorer environment.

    Possible Causes:

    1. Configuration Issues: There may be misconfigurations in the Explorer settings or in the BW system that prevent the update from completing successfully.
    2. Authorization Problems: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the update or access certain settings.
    3. System Performance: If the system is under heavy load or if there are performance issues, the update process may be delayed or fail.
    4. Network Issues: Connectivity problems between the SAP BW system and the Explorer can lead to issues in updating settings.
    5. Version Compatibility: There may be compatibility issues between different versions of SAP BW and Explorer.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Configuration: Review the configuration settings for the Explorer and ensure that they are set up correctly. This includes checking the connection settings to the BW system.
    2. Review Authorizations: Ensure that the user executing the update has the necessary authorizations to perform the action. This may involve checking roles and permissions in the SAP system.
    3. Monitor System Performance: Check the performance of the SAP system. If the system is slow or unresponsive, consider optimizing performance or scheduling updates during off-peak hours.
    4. Network Connectivity: Verify that there are no network issues affecting the connection between the Explorer and the BW system. This may involve checking firewalls, proxies, or other network configurations.
    5. Check for Updates: Ensure that both the SAP BW and Explorer are updated to the latest versions. Sometimes, applying patches or updates can resolve compatibility issues.
    6. Review Logs: Check the system log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
